What is BuildingConnected?
BuildingConnected, founded in 2012 and based in San Francisco, California, operates as a sophisticated preconstruction platform. Its core function is to empower real estate owners and general contractors by streamlining the process of hiring qualified contractors for their diverse projects. The platform facilitates efficient communication, bidding, and selection, aiming to reduce project risks and improve outcomes in the construction lifecycle. How much funding has BuildingConnected raised?
BuildingConnected has raised a total of $47.7M across 4 funding rounds:

Other Financing Round (2014): $2.2M with participation from Zachary Aarons, Homebrew Ventures, Eric Schiermeyer, Kris Gale, Freestyle Capital, and Darren Bechtel
Series A (2015): $8.5M led by CrossLink Capital, Bee Partners, Homebrew Management LLC, Freestyle Capital, and Brick & Mortar Ventures
Series B (2017): $22M supported by Crosslink Capital, Homebrew Ventures, Lightspeed Venture Partners, and Freestyle Capital
Other Financing Round (2018): $15M featuring Brookfield Ventures
Key Investors in BuildingConnected
Homebrew Ventures
Homebrew is a venture capital firm specializing in early-stage technology investments, known for its hands-on approach and support for founders.
Freestyle Capital
Freestyle VC is an early-stage venture capital firm that invests in technology companies, providing strategic guidance and support to help founders scale their businesses.
Crosslink Capital
Crosslink Capital is an investment firm that partners with ambitious early-stage founders to build category-defining companies, with a focus on seed and Series A investments.
